A 3-axis vertical machining center (VMC) operates on three distinct axes (X, Y, and Z) to precisely control the movement of cutting tools. This design allows for intricate and complex shapes to be machined efficiently, making it an essential tool in modern manufacturing.

These machining centers are adaptable for various materials, from metals to plastics, making them suitable for different industries such as aerospace, automotive, and medical device manufacturing.
